The helipad marks a major change to the traditional image of presidents departing from the White House lawn, where prior Marine One variants have historically landed directly on the grass, using small portable aluminum pads for the wheels.
However, the new birds’ more powerful engines and downward facing exhausts has limited their use over concerns about damaging and burning the lawn.
The president and his entourage will now be able to walk on a paved walkway directly to the pad from the White House without stepping on wet or muddy grass. Another issue Trump has also highlighted with regard to the — now paved — grassy are of the Rose Garden.
The VH-92A Patriot made its first presidential flight in 2024, carrying Joe Biden. Although the aircraft has entered service with the Marine Corps’ HMX-1 presidential lift helicopter squadron, older helicopters in its fleet have continued to be used for some White House operations because of those South Lawn concerns.

The Marine One fleet is currently made up of three Sikorsky helicopter types: the older VH-3D Sea King, introduced in the 1970s; the VH-60N White Hawk, a variant of the ubiquitous Blackhawk, introduced in the late 1980s; and the newer VH-92A Patriot.
The VH-92A was developed to replace the ageing VH-3D and VH-60N aircraft with a more modern platform offering greater capacity, improved communications, and increased mission capability.
The new Marine One’s interior features a highly secure, much more modern, and elegant soundproofed cabin that seats up to 14 passengers, complete with plush leather seating and a private lavatory. It also has military-grade encrypted communication, ballistic armor, anti-missile defense systems, and Electromagnetic Pulse (EMP) shielding. It is also the first presidential first helicopter equipped with SpaceX Starshield satellite communications.
To ensure maximum security, Marine One always flies in a formation of up to five identical helicopters, with the President on board only one of them to serve as a decoy. And now it will be able to land regularly on its own pad on the South Lawn of the White House.
